The glowing diyas. The bangin' bhangra and Bollywood beats. The spicy samosas and gajar halwa. And the dazzling sarees, lenghas,cholis and dupattas.

Diwali is more than just a celebration of lights; for many, it's a celebration of life. And Diwali fashion is just as vibrant as the festival itself.

As many gather this week, they'll don their finery to honour the new moon, traditions, and connections between friends and family.

A few Canadian designers and retailers share some popular Diwali looks this year.

Blue belle

Dinesh

Designer Dinesh Ramsay's eye-catching outfit is perfect for Diwali with its stunning shades of blue, which complements the vibrants colours of the festival.

The raw silk, full-flair 10-panel lehenga with handmade thread embroidery pairs well with a short choli-style blouse and stylish modern dupatta.

Golden hours

This regal jacket-style dress is worn over a raw silk lehengas with a grand flare. The overlay is intricately embroidered with various gold shades of zardosi, antique zari, pearls, resham and just enough mirrors to give it a traditionally modern look.
